How Much Does a Title Analyst Make in District of Columbia?

Updated March 01, 2025
As of March 01, 2025, the average annual pay of Title Analyst in District of Columbia is $53,222. While Salary.com is seeing that Title Analyst salary in DC can go up to $70,503 or down to $37,240, but most earn between $44,856 and $62,268. Salary ranges can vary widely depending on many important factors, including education, certifications, additional skills, and your experience levels.
